Study on Flue-cured Tobacco Seedling Culture in Sand-cultured Floating System

  • For reducing seedling culture cost,tobacco sand-cultured floating system was studied,where sand was the only growing medium.The results showed that:comparing with existing floating system,the sand-cultured system featured higher germination percentage and more uniform seedling size,and the whole seedling stage took about 60 days.The seedlings grew slower until 4 true leaves stage,and it was 2-3 days slower than existing system;afterwards seedlings grew as fast as those growing in the existing system.The characteristics of the seedlings,including stem height and circumstance,area of biggest leaf,dry material accumulation,total root number and vitality of root systems,NR enzyme's activity and chlorophyll content,developed slowly in early growing stage and rapidly in late growing stage.However,the chlorophyll content,NR enzyme's activity and vitality of root systems decreased in late stage of seedling desired to plant.It was concluded that the seedlings cultured in sand-cultured floating system grew vigorously and had well developed root system,moreover,its cost of culture was reduced by 56.58% compared with existing floating system.
